GaitherNews Escape the Algorithm
Today --°
Updated
Categories
Technology 1 source 0 views

Formal Methods and the Future of Programming

Article excerpt

Jane Street, the quantitative trading firm, published a survey of formal methods, mathematical techniques for proving software correctness, exploring how these rigorous approaches might reshape programming. The piece examines tools and methodologies that verify code properties before execution, reducing bugs in critical systems. Rather than treating formal methods as purely academic, Jane Street considers their practical role in high-stakes trading environments where a single error can cost millions. The article catalogs existing approaches, from type systems to automated theorem provers, and speculates on barriers to wider adoption in mainstream software development.